What Is a Stainless Steel Nut? 

A stainless steel nut is a threaded fastener made from stainless steel alloy, designed to mate with a bolt, screw, or stud to form a secure mechanical joint. Unlike mild steel or zinc-plated alternatives, stainless steel nuts resist oxidation, moisture, and chemical attack — making them indispensable in demanding environments. Their naturally passive oxide layer self-repairs on exposure to oxygen, meaning they maintain integrity even after years of field service. 

Common Types of Stainless Steel Nuts 

The market offers a wide variety of stainless steel nuts to suit different engineering demands: 

  • Hex Nuts: The most widely used type, available in full and half (jam) variants. Suitable for general-purpose bolted assemblies. 

  • Flange Nuts: Feature a built-in washer-like base that distributes load across a wider surface area, reducing stress concentrations. 

  • Lock Nuts (Nyloc): Incorporate a nylon insert that resists loosening under vibration — ideal for automotive and machinery applications. 

  • Wing Nuts: Allow hand-tightening without tools, commonly used in maintenance panels and temporary assemblies. 

  • Coupling Nuts: Elongated hex nuts used to join two externally threaded rods end-to-end. 

  • Cap Nuts (Acorn Nuts): Provide a finished, decorative cover over exposed bolt threads, protecting against corrosion and injury. 

  • Square Nuts: Offer greater contact area for a stronger grip, often used in channel and framing applications. 

Material Grades: SS 304 vs SS 316 

Two grades dominate the stainless steel nuts market: 

SS 304 (18% chromium, 8% nickel) is the most cost-effective grade. It resists oxidation and mild corrosion, making it the go-to choice for indoor construction, food equipment, and general engineering. SS 316 adds 2–3% molybdenum, significantly boosting resistance to chlorides, saltwater, and industrial chemicals. It is the standard choice for offshore platforms, coastal construction, pharmaceutical equipment, and marine environments. 

Specialty grades like SS 310, SS 410, and duplex stainless are also available from a professional ss nut manufacturer for extreme temperature or high-strength requirements. 

Key Industrial Applications 

  • Oil & Gas: Flanges, valves, and pipelines require SS 316 nuts to withstand corrosive hydrocarbons and seawater. 

  • Chemical Processing: Reactor vessels and storage tanks rely on corrosion-resistant fasteners to maintain structural integrity. 

  • Food & Beverage: Hygienic environments mandate non-reactive, easy-to-clean SS 304 or SS 316 fasteners. 

  • Construction & Infrastructure: Bridges, facades, and structural steelwork use stainless nuts to prevent rust staining and structural degradation. 

  • Automotive & Marine: Vibration resistance and saltwater protection are critical; stainless lock and flange nuts are preferred.

Standards & Dimensions 

Stainless steel nuts are manufactured to internationally recognised standards including DIN 934 (hex nuts), ISO 4032, ASME B18.2.2, and BS 1769. Dimensions vary by thread size (M3 to M100+ for metric; 1/4" to 4" for imperial), and it is critical to match the nut standard to your bolt standard to ensure thread compatibility and load-rated performance.
